How do female coaches handle being in the locker room with their male athletes?
Female coaches working with male athletes may encounter challenges when entering the locker room. Here's how they navigate this space:
- Establish clear communication and expectations: Coaches inform athletes about their presence in the locker room, setting boundaries and ensuring privacy.
- Respect boundaries: Coaches avoid entering the locker room without prior notice, allowing athletes sufficient time to change and maintain their privacy.
- Dress appropriately: Coaches adhere to team dress codes and avoid wearing revealing clothing that could make athletes uncomfortable.
- Professional demeanor: Female coaches maintain a professional and respectful demeanor at all times, treating athletes with respect and avoiding any inappropriate behavior.
- Focus on the coaching roles: Coaches prioritize their role as coaches, focusing on providing guidance and support to athletes, while maintaining a professional distance.
